"A shining example of representation in literature, Starr Green's SAILING IN THE SKY pairs an autistic teen protagonist with a whimsical plot that makes for a stunning urban-fantasy debut." -IndieReader

In a magical world shifting under her feet from moment to moment, who should she trust?

An autistic teen runaway, Piper never believed in magic until faced with a sea dragon. A simple choice between helping the creature or catching her getaway bus propels her into a tangled mystery with Irish gods from myth. Not able to return home, she must decide to keep running or trust the fae.

MacLir, the youthful guardian of the seas, doesn't see the point in spending time with mortals until he meets Piper. When girls go missing near the faerie mounds, he joins the perilous search as an excuse to spend more time with her. A plan complicated by the return of an old enemy that he can't defeat alone.

Read the enchanting first installment of Piper's journey in Wave Sweeper Trilogy's Book One. A fast-paced YA urban fantasy with sweet romance, this trilogy follows a female autistic lead in a contemporary reimagining of Irish legends.


Green, Starr: - Starr Green is an autistic creative thinker, and when not writing, is pulled in all directions as a mom and administrative assistant. She lives in the Pacific Northwest and has a degree specializing in Environmental Communication from Oregon State University. As a teen, she was delighted by all the worlds she discovered in the local library. Her debut novel Castaway Strangers is the first of her many fantasy books with female autistic characters.
